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Responsible for providing management of assigned projects.
- Direct and oversee the design and implementation of infrastructure solutions.
- Interface with IT Resources, Management Teams, and other Business Partners on a regular basis to maintain good client relations and resolve any issues.
- Responsible for schedule and budget while ensuring that all project milestones are delivered according to plan.
- Serve as the central point of contact and primary interface for all project related issues.
- Oversee the full lifecycle development and implementation program as well as technical activities to ensure successful project execution and meeting of requirements.
- Perform all project management functions including; work breakdown and cost estimation, scheduling, monitoring and tracking of technical progress against the defined timetables and budgets, and staff assignment and development.
- Supervise and manage all staff assigned to the project, assign, and direct their activities.
- Identify and assess new functional capabilities supporting engineering change proposals and additional follow-on work.
- Coaches and reviews the work of lower-level professionals.
- Guide and partner with the team to architect, develop, and implement high-quality software systems and application solutions.
- Provide strong technical and business leadership to cross-functional development teams, ensuring the team adheres to industry best practices while also fostering a culture of innovation and creative problem-solving.
- Drive enterprise software architecture and manage the end-to-end SDLC, including requirements discovery, feasibility and impact evaluation, system design, development, integration, deployment, and operational support.
- Develop and maintain effective processes for managing requirements, developing business processes, and providing production support to
the operation.
- Design and implement process improvements that enhance customer service and optimize business operational efficiency and quality.
- Conduct analyses and evaluate a wide variety of information to assess operational difficulties and develop solutions to complex problems, including escalated issues.
- Serve as a liaison between the development team and Operations for the planning, implementation and maintenance of programs and contractual changes.
- Confidently facilitate internal and client-facing meetings, ensuring clear communication, structure, and effective outcomes
- Develop high quality communications suitable for clients.
- Maintain extensive and comprehensive working knowledge of all assigned programs and projects.
- Skilled in managing shifting and competing priorities with efficiency and sound judgment.
Minimum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in relevant field of study and 5+ years of relevant professional experience required, or equivalent combination of education and experience.
